SARDINIA Spanish Language Bibliography of Sardinia
BIBLIOGRAPHIA ESPANOLA de CERDENA por D. EDUARDO TODA Y GUELL
Tipographia de los Huerfanos Madrid 1890 1890. Book. Very Good. Hardcover. First Edition. Royal 8vo original cloth & boards. 326pp. Index Indice de Titulos. Extensive introductory material & Appendices. Further stated on title page: "OBRA PREMIADA POR LA BIBLIOTECA NACIONAL en el concurso publico de 1887 Y PUBLICADA A EXPENSAS DEL ESTADO. This appears to be a very important bibliography related to the island of Sardinia which was primarily under Spanish rule until 1718. The bibliography with 818 entries begins with Spanish inculabula. The main bibliographical text is in three sections: "Libros hispano-sardos" "Manuscritos y codices existentes en Cerdena" "La imprenta en Cerdena". Satire Menippee.
SATYRE MENIPPEE, De La Vertu Du Catholicon D'Espagne, Et De La Tenue Des Etats De Paris. A laquelle est ajoute un Discours sur L'interpretation du mot de Higueiro Del Inferno, & qui en est l'Auteur.
Three volumes. Engraved frontis and other engraved plates, two of them folding. Inconsequential marginal worming in one volume. 16mo. Worn leather backed boards binding. Spines should be replaced. XLib. [French Art Alliance, New York]. An important satire which parodies the assembly of the Etats Generaux held in 1593 (with the object of electing a Catholic King). It expresses the views in favor of the claims of Henri IV while opposing the Ligue [Spanish League and its supporters]. The satires greatly influenced the outcome of the assembly, and Henry IV was elected. The work is divided into three parts. It begins with a burlesque description of the opening procession of the assembly and this is followed in the second part by a catalogue of the chief Ligueurs and imaginary speeches by real persons. Finally, there are miscellaneous satires and epigrams. Written at the moment of the defeat of the Ligue, it was an immediate 'best-seller'. Authorship is usually ascribed to Jean Leroy, a canon of Rouen, with the collaboration of Jean Passerat, Pierre Pithou, Nicolas Rapim and others. This is the standard eighteenth century edition. The title of the lampoon derives from Saturae Menippeae, lost work of Varro based on satires by the Greek cynic Menippus. Brunet V-145; Cohen-De Rici 939. FR2
